Popular Welder’s Certificates

While the AWS’ regular CW (Certified Welder) credential paves the way for the majority of jobs, some fields mandate their own specialized certificate. Some of the most-popular of these are highlighted below.

  • SCWI and CWI Certificates for inspectors and senior inspectors
  • API Certification for those who work with pipelines in the gas and oil field
  • Certified Welder Certificates to be a Certified Welder
  • ASME Certification for individuals that work on boiler and pressure containers

The below data displays job and earnings forecasts for welders in the State of Ohio through 2022.

Ohio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 13,760 14,370 4% 400
Ohio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$24,800 $35,300 $50,800

Source: O*Net Online
